Related Product Features:
  • Simulates natural blue sky sunlight using nano particle technology for Rayleigh scattering effect.
  • Offers a vertical sunlight experience with a 90° lighting angle for dynamic sun movement.
  • Supports dimming and adjustable brightness via switch, remote, Tuya app, or voice control.
  • Available in two series: RYOPT 90° for vertical sunlight and RYOPT 30° for warm grazing light.
  • Thin design at just 29.5cm, suitable for recessed or surface mounting.
  • High lumen flux of 8000lm for smart sky and 6000lm for classical options.
  • Long lifespan of 50,000 hours with LED nanoparticle panel lighting source.
  • Compatible with Alexa, Google Assistant, and Zigbee for smart home integration.

  • How does the wireless control feature work?
    The skylight supports intelligent control via the Tuya app, which can be connected to Alexa, Google Assistant, or Zigbee for voice and remote control.
  • What are the mounting options for the skylight panel?
    The panel can be installed as recessed flat (1206x606mm) or frame exposure (1185x585mm), with a required height of 320mm between roof and gypsum board.
